This sewing box, or "haribako," has three drawers and an open top divided into small compartments with a handle for easy carrying and moving.
Originally, these pieces of furniture served as sewing boxes, where "hari" refers to sewing needles and "bako" to box or chest.
Today, this small piece of furniture is also useful for storing writing materials, art supplies, jewelry, and more.
The piece is of high quality and made from beautifully grained wood.
Dimensions: height 19 cm, width 28 cm, depth 18 cm. The manufacturer's label is still present.
